Aurangabad, Nov 12: Aurangabad division bench of Bombay High Court comprising Justice S P Deshmukh and Justice S D Kulkarni on Thursday admitted petitions for medical education completion up to postgraduate from Economic Weaker Section (EWS).

But, hearing on a petting seeking EWS benefit for just one year instead of whole education will be held after Diwali vacation.

According to details, some girl students filed petitions in the court seeking benefit of EWS for Maratha community for the academic year 2020-21. The court in today’s hearing showed readiness to provide the benefit of EWS till the completion of the medical education. However, the HC made it clear that the petitioners would be able to get the benefit of SEBC Act if it comes into existence in future.

So, petitioners Vedangi Sudhakar Kapre, Devyani Thombre and Kalyani Vyavhare showed readiness to avail of EWS for only one year while other petitioners Smita Bhimraao Shingte and Srushti Bhimrao Shingte who have EWS certificate are ready to take its benefit for the completion of whole medical education.

Adv Vinod Patil appeared for petitioners Vedangi, Devyani and Kalyani while advocates Y K Bobde and Atul Havle represented Smita and Srushti.

Chief Government pleader D R Kale appeared for the Government. Advocates Mrugesh Narwadkar and Kishor Sant represented CET Cell and Maharashtra University of Health Sciences respectively.
